The film follows a lonely Michael Jackson impersonator who is invited by a beautiful Marilyn Monroe to a commune in the Scottish Highlands full of other impersonators, including the Queen of England, Madonna, Sammy Davis Jr., and James Dean. In a parallel storyline, the incomparable Werner Herzog plays a Latin American priest who learns his missionary of nuns can literally fly. (IFC Films) …Expand

I feel like this is quite a good film but its just so surreal/quirky/bizarre that it's not a film I imagine everyone can/will enjoy but its not a bad film either. I'm sort of on the fence about it as some scenes I thought were quite good and plot wise it has a quite interesting storyline but it is one of those films which, having finished seeing it, I'm left wondering what I'm meant to take away from it. It is somewhat philosophical I guess, perhaps making you think about self identity, how we choose to run away from our humdrum lives and so on. Its a little too bizarre for me but it does work on one level or two. It won't appeal to everyone but I guess if it sounds of interest, then it may be worth seeing, yes.…Expand
